I remember Greer claiming he briefed James Woolsey on UFO matters when all Greer did was pay for a seat at a very expensive fund-raising dinner (that almost any civilian could attend). He then walked up to Woolsey's dinner table and confronted him. Thats all that happened, this was Greer's "briefing" in his delusional mind (to a sitting CIA director no less):
en.wikipedia.org...
I believe Woolsey later made Greer write a public detraction in one of his books, but I'm not sure the details of all that
